Output 52bd774c6e7dec67d207b8fbd609e3e7284dae22b6e931e0591940a24e7dc35a:0

value
52569991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55a06b7f0f942df75428c077bcf4fb3a3932d5b9 OP_EQUAL
address
MFhuquXEUEgkeaC2vJ3SN8jrBeSBKszSng
transaction
52bd774c6e7dec67d207b8fbd609e3e7284dae22b6e931e0591940a24e7dc35a
spent
true